nginx 0.1.29
*) Feature: the ngx_http_ssi_module supports "include virtual" command.
*) Feature: the ngx_http_ssi_module supports the condition command like
'if expr="$NAME"' and "else" and "endif" commands. Only one nested
level is supported.
*) Feature: the ngx_http_ssi_module supports the DATE_LOCAL and
DATE_GMT variables and "config timefmt" command.
*) Feature: the "ssi_ignore_recycled_buffers" directive.
*) Bugfix: the "echo" command did not show the default value for the
empty QUERY_STRING variable.
*) Change: the ngx_http_proxy_module was rewritten.
*) Feature: the "proxy_redirect", "proxy_pass_request_headers",
"proxy_pass_request_body", and "proxy_method" directives.
*) Feature: the "proxy_set_header" directive. The "proxy_x_var" was
canceled and must be replaced with the proxy_set_header directive.
*) Change: the "proxy_preserve_host" is canceled and must be replaced
with the "proxy_set_header Host $host" and the "proxy_redirect off"
directives, the "proxy_set_header Host $host:$proxy_port" directive
and the appropriate proxy_redirect directives.
*) Change: the "proxy_set_x_real_ip" is canceled and must be replaced
with the "proxy_set_header X-Real-IP $remote_addr" directive.
*) Change: the "proxy_add_x_forwarded_for" is canceled and must be
replaced with
the "pro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-For $proxy_add_x_forwarded_for"
directive.
*) Change: the "proxy_set_x_url" is canceled and must be replaced with
the "proxy_set_header X-URL http://$host:$server_port$request_uri"
directive.
*) Feature: the "fastcgi_param" directive.
*) Change: the "fastcgi_root", "fastcgi_set_var" and "fastcgi_params"
directive are canceled and must be replaced with the fastcgi_param
directives.
*) Feature: the "index" directive can use the variables.
*) Feature: the "index" directive can be used at http and server levels.
*) Change: the last index only in the "index" directive can be absolute.
*) Feature: the "rewrite" directive can use the variables.
*) Feature: the "internal" directive.
*) Feature: the CONTENT_LENGTH, CONTENT_TYPE, REMOTE_PORT, SERVER_ADDR,
SERVER_PORT, SERVER_PROTOCOL, DOCUMENT_ROOT, SERVER_NAME,
REQUEST_METHOD, REQUEST_URI, and REMOTE_USER variables.
*) Change: nginx now passes the invalid lines in a client request
headers or a backend response header.
*) Bugfix: if the backend did not transfer response for a long time and
the "send_timeout" was less than "proxy_read_timeout", then nginx
returned the 408 response.
*) Bugfix: the segmentation fault was occurred if the backend sent an
invalid line in response header; bug appeared in 0.1.26.
*) Bugfix: the segmentation fault may occurred in FastCGI fault
tolerance configuration.
*) Bugfix: the "expires" directive did not remove the previous
"Expires" and "Cache-Control" headers.
*) Bugfix: nginx did not take into account trailing dot in "Host"
header line.
*) Bugfix: the ngx_http_auth_module did not work under Linux.
*) Bugfix: the rewrite directive worked incorrectly, if the arguments
were in a request.
*) Bugfix: nginx could not be built on MacOS X.

/* * Copyright (C) Igor Sysoev */ #ifndef _NGX_FREEBSD_RFORK_THREAD_H_INCLUDED_ #define _NGX_FREEBSD_RFORK_THREAD_H_INCLUDED_ #include <sys/ipc.h> #include <sys/sem.h> #include <sched.h> typedef pid_t ngx_tid_t; #undef ngx_log_pid #define ngx_log_pid ngx_thread_self() #define ngx_log_tid 0 #define NGX_TID_T_FMT "%P" #define NGX_MUTEX_LIGHT 1 #define NGX_MUTEX_LOCK_BUSY 0x80000000 typedef volatile struct { ngx_atomic_t lock; ngx_log_t *log; int semid; } ngx_mutex_t; #define NGX_CV_SIGNAL 64 typedef struct { int signo; int kq; ngx_tid_t tid; ngx_log_t *log; } ngx_cond_t; #define ngx_thread_sigmask(how, set, oset) \ (sigprocmask(how, set, oset) == -1) ? ngx_errno : 0 #define ngx_thread_sigmask_n "sigprocmask()" #define ngx_thread_join(t, p) #define ngx_setthrtitle(n) setproctitle(n) extern char *ngx_freebsd_kern_usrstack; extern size_t ngx_thread_stack_size; static ngx_inline ngx_int_t ngx_gettid() { char *sp; if (ngx_thread_stack_size == 0) { return 0; } #if ( __i386__ ) __asm__ volatile ("mov %%esp, %0" : "=q" (sp)); #elif ( __amd64__ ) __asm__ volatile ("mov %%rsp, %0" : "=q" (sp)); #else #error "rfork()ed threads are not supported on this platform" #endif return (ngx_freebsd_kern_usrstack - sp) / ngx_thread_stack_size; } ngx_tid_t ngx_thread_self(); typedef ngx_uint_t ngx_tls_key_t; #define NGX_THREAD_KEYS_MAX 16 extern void **ngx_tls; ngx_err_t ngx_thread_key_create(ngx_tls_key_t *key); #define ngx_thread_key_create_n "the tls key creation" ngx_err_t ngx_thread_set_tls(ngx_tls_key_t key, void *value); #define ngx_thread_set_tls_n "the tls key setting" static void *ngx_thread_get_tls(ngx_tls_key_t key) { if (key >= NGX_THREAD_KEYS_MAX) { return NULL; } return ngx_tls[key * NGX_THREAD_KEYS_MAX + ngx_gettid()]; } #define ngx_mutex_trylock(m) ngx_mutex_dolock(m, 1) #define ngx_mutex_lock(m) ngx_mutex_dolock(m, 0) ngx_int_t ngx_mutex_dolock(ngx_mutex_t *m, ngx_int_t try); ngx_int_t ngx_mutex_unlock(ngx_mutex_t *m); typedef int (*ngx_rfork_thread_func_pt)(void *arg); #endif /* _NGX_FREEBSD_RFORK_THREAD_H_INCLUDED_ */
